Output dd7f70fb5a851bb2cb8fd31a42c2b3e6edd892eec25e4b26f758ca2edb21a514:1

value
992339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0188973f295e57c3424e74255221de85ac557ecb OP_EQUAL
address
31q8EENFFvUmAVh5BGw57x7zWt3SwoW2Jo
transaction
dd7f70fb5a851bb2cb8fd31a42c2b3e6edd892eec25e4b26f758ca2edb21a514
confirmations
323556
spent
true